Shanika Esparaz, MD
Shanika Esparaz is a practicing and board-certified ophthalmologist and fellowship-trained medical retina specialist. She has been practicing for 6 years in northeast Ohio. She recently became board certified in lifestyle medicine to be an advocate to physicians, colleagues, and patients on preventative medicine and how that can apply to your eyes, especially for the conditions she manages, such as macular degeneration and diabetic retinopathy.
Dr. Esparaz loves educating on social medial platforms about retinal health and wellness and also about being a mother in medicine. She has had the honor of being featured in Healio videos, most recently on Mend the Gap.
